I would make this again, but I'd do what we ordinarily do and that's to use a flour tortilla for the crust. Lightly coat with EVOO and pop under the broiler to crisp both sides, patting it down with a spatula if it puffs. Then top with your pizza toppings and cheese and bake until cheese has melted and toppings are warmed through. Saves a lot of calories using the tortilla crust!
